About MDU
MDU Resources Group Inc. provides electric and natural gas distribution services across the Pacific Northwest and Midwest. Its segments include electric, natural gas distribution, and pipeline. Its electric segment provides electric service at retail, serving residential, commercial, industrial and municipal customers in approximately 185 communities and adjacent rural areas. It has interests in approximately 15 electric generating units at 12 facilities and two small portable diesel generators. Its natural gas distribution segment sells natural gas at retail, serving residential, commercial and industrial customers in approximately 343 communities and adjacent rural areas across eight states. Its pipeline segment owns and operates WBI Energy Transmission, a FERC regulated pipeline, which consists of over 3,800 miles of natural gas transmission and storage lines. WBI Energy also owns and operates a non-regulated energy-related service business, specializing in cathodic protection.

- Coverage Initiation: J.P. Morgan has initiated coverage on MDU Resources with a Neutral rating and a $22 price target, citing positive sales growth trends and regulatory diversification as key factors supporting growth durability.
- Valuation Concerns: Analyst Aidan Kelly noted that MDU's current double-digit premium valuation reflects its growth runway, yet this limits room for multiple expansion, indicating market caution regarding its future performance.
- Execution Challenges: Under MDU's base plan, Kelly anticipates a targeted 6%-8% compound annual growth rate for earnings per share, but the narrow margin for execution is concerning when factoring in the gap between rate base growth and equity needs.
- Project Potential: Despite challenges, Kelly highlighted WBI Energy's upcoming Bakken East project as a core lever that could elevate realized EPS growth above the current range in 2029-30, underscoring the project's significance.

- Position Change: Corvex Management sold its entire position of 4,183,151 shares in MDU Resources Group during Q4 2025, resulting in a $74.5 million decrease in the position's quarter-end value, indicating a potential loss of confidence in the company.
- Financial Performance: MDU Resources Group reported a net income of $190.44 million for 2025 with diluted EPS of $0.93, and it projects EPS between $0.93 and $1.00 for 2026, showcasing its profitability in the stable utility sector.
- Capital Allocation Strategy: The sale reflects Corvex's shift of capital away from MDU towards higher-growth investments like Illumina and Amazon, indicating a preference for asymmetric risk over predictable returns, which may impact MDU's future market performance.
- Industry Outlook: MDU achieved a 16% year-over-year growth rate in its rate base, with CEO Nicole Kivisto calling 2025 a “transformative year” and planning to invest $560 million in capital expenditures in 2026, highlighting the company's long-term growth potential in infrastructure and energy.

- Dividend Declaration: MDU Resources Group's board has declared a quarterly dividend of 14 cents per share, unchanged from the previous quarter, demonstrating the company's ongoing commitment to stable dividends aimed at attracting long-term investors.
- Dividend Payment Date: This dividend will be payable on April 1, 2026, to stockholders of record as of March 12, 2026, ensuring timely returns for shareholders and enhancing investor confidence.
- Long-term Dividend Target: The company continues to target a long-term dividend payout ratio of 60% to 70% of earnings, reflecting its focus on sustainable profitability and shareholder returns, aiming to maintain stable cash flows in the future.
